The Core of the Argument
Elon Musk's position is a blend of long-held concern and recent acceptance. For years, he has called artificial intelligence humanity's "biggest existential threat" and advocated for government regulation to manage public safety risks. His fear has been
that if we wait for a catastrophe to happen, it might be too late to implement rules because the AI could already be beyond our control. However, his tune has shifted recently. While still acknowledging a non-zero risk, he now believes the pace of development is too fast and the competition too fierce to halt. He describes his current philosophy as, "Let's enjoy the ride," suggesting the most likely outcome is a new age of prosperity. This paradox captures the essence of the global AI dilemma: the technology's development feels both terrifyingly risky and unavoidably necessary.
A Planet of AI Players
Musk's belief is grounded in a simple reality: AI development isn't happening in one country or one company. It's a sprawling, global phenomenon. The United States and China are widely seen as the two superpowers in the AI race, pouring billions into research, talent, and infrastructure. But they are far from alone. The European Union is positioning itself as a regulatory leader, hoping its AI Act will set a global standard, much like its GDPR data privacy rules did. Meanwhile, countries like the UAE and Singapore are leading the world in AI adoption, integrating the technology across business and government services at a rapid pace. Nations including the UK, Canada, Japan, South Korea, and India are also significant players, establishing their own AI safety institutes and contributing to a complex web of international cooperation and competition. This diffusion of power and ambition makes a unified pause or stop button a practical impossibility.
The Geopolitical Prisoner's Dilemma
The global AI race is often described as a classic prisoner's dilemma. Even if every nation agreed that slowing down is the safest option for humanity, the incentive for any single nation to secretly push ahead for a strategic advantage is immense. This dynamic is fueled by deep-seated economic and military competition. No major power wants to be left behind, technologically dependent on a rival. Different regions are also creating regulations based on their own values. For instance, China's approach prioritizes state control and social stability, requiring AI content to align with government principles. In contrast, the EU and US are attempting to build frameworks around democratic values and individual rights, though they differ on the balance between innovation and regulation. This fragmentation means that even with good intentions, complying with one region's rules might conflict with another's, making a single, enforceable global treaty incredibly difficult to achieve.
The Regulatory Uphill Battle
Despite the difficulty, efforts to govern AI are underway. A series of international summits, from Bletchley Park in 2023 to Paris in 2025, have tried to build consensus on AI safety. Organizations like the International Network of AI Safety Institutes bring together experts from dozens of nations to collaborate on mitigating risks. However, these efforts face significant hurdles. The technology is evolving faster than lawmakers can write rules. Furthermore, there is a fundamental tension between ensuring safety and fostering innovation, with some leaders warning that overly strict rules could stifle progress. While many top scientists agree on the need for 'red lines'—such as prohibiting AIs that can autonomously replicate or seek power—enforcing such rules globally remains a profound challenge. The very nature of AI, which is less like a physical weapon and more like software, makes it harder to monitor and control than technologies like nuclear arms.
